EP 714 Pizza and Wine Experts

Gary Vaynerchuk tries some pizza and pairs three wines with pizza expert guest.

Wines tasted in this episode:

2008 Shaya RuedaRueda
2007 Il Maniaco Montepulciano D’abruzzoMontepulciano d’Abruzzo
2005 Hewitson Miss HarryAustralian Red Blend
